Output 1389e02d5e9002361918faec0560ea63df61c8a57b268c45aa75d12a6e85b4af:44

value
582533
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c2b4488c09e1c9ae6082a01be9dda99c0bf00b8 OP_EQUALVERIFY OP_CHECKSIG
address
152YZjZfrwrG8yCy2uHSjtAs3pF8aBQuRw
transaction
1389e02d5e9002361918faec0560ea63df61c8a57b268c45aa75d12a6e85b4af
spent
true